How they compare

Ireland currently reports 2,611 m3 against 2 m3 in Middle Africa, a difference of 2,609 m3.

That makes Ireland's figure about 1,305.5 times Middle Africa's.

The two have swapped places 6 times across 31 shared years of data; in 1994 it was Ireland ahead.

Ireland ranks 26th and Middle Africa ranks 10th of 215 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Ireland averaged higher in 3 and Middle Africa in 1.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
